Brown hornbill with a white belly and a yellow-and-orange bill. The white outer tail feathers and wing patches are conspicuous in flight. Found in arid savanna. Usually solitary or in pairs; sometimes in small flocks. Call is a series of clucking notes that accelerates and becomes louder. Fairly similar to Bradfield’s Hornbill, but has white in the wings, much more white in the tail, and a yellow base to the bill.
